Division of Biology seminar Oct. 28 canceled

Submitted by Division of Biology

****Note: This event has been canceled****

Andrew Hendry, professor in the department of biology at McGill University and leader in the field of eco-evolutionary dynamics, will deliver a seminar in the Division of Biology titled, "Eco-Evolutionary Dynamics in Galapagos" at 3:30 p.m. Monday, Oct. 28, in 221 Ackert Hall.

Hendry's main research interest is how evolution interacts with ecological change and how evolution feeds back to influence ecological change. He has researched broadly on eco-evolutionary dynamics in various systems, including three-spine sticklebacks, Trinidadian guppies and Darwin's finches. He will speak on his work with Darwin's finches on the Galapagos and how they have evolved in response to differences in seed distributions.
